目的探讨载脂蛋白A-I(ApoA-I)半胱氨酸突变体重组高密度脂蛋白(r HDL)对大鼠急性痛风性关节炎的影响。方法健康雄性Wistar大鼠25只,随机分为空白对照组、模型组、卵磷脂组、r HDL74干预组、r HDLwt干预组,每组5只。除空白对照组外其余4组采用右侧踝关节注入尿酸钠晶体诱导急性痛风性关节炎模型,造模后4组分别通过尾静脉注射生理盐水、大豆卵磷脂溶液、r HDL74、r HDLwt进行干预。软尺测量造模后0、2、4、6、8、10 h大鼠踝关节周径;造模10 h后,乙醚麻醉大鼠,内眦取血并取关节腔滑膜组织,ELESA法检测血清中白细胞介素1β(IL-1β)水平,常规检查大鼠关节滑膜的病理学变化。结果与模型组比较,r HDL74能明显抑制关节腔肿胀程度(F=9.61~45.84,q=2.13~16.35,P<0.05),r HDL74及r HDLwt能显著降低血清中IL-1β的水平(F=43.67,q=2.33~16.85,P<0.05);与模型组比较,r HDL74及r HDLwt能明显降低尿酸钠晶体诱导的炎症细胞浸润。结论 r HDL74及r HDLwt对尿酸钠晶体诱导大鼠急性痛风性关节炎有显著的改善作用。
Objective To investigate the effect of lipid-bound cysteine mutants of apoA-I on acute gouty arthritis in rats.Methods Twenty-five male Wistar rats were equally randomized to five groups: control group,model group,lecithin group,rHDL74 group,and rHDLwt group.A rat model of acute gouty arthritis was created by injection of sodium urate crystal(MSU) into the right ankle of the rats,except those in the control group.Upon completion of the models,they were then separately infused with normal saline,soybean lecithin solution,rHDL74,and rHDLwt through vena caudalis into the four groups for intervention.A tape rule was used to measure the circumference of the ankles at 0 h,2 h,4 h,6 h,8 h,and 10 h after the establishment of the models.After 10 hours,blood samples and synovium of articular cavity of the models were taken under ethyl anesthesia.Serum IL-1β level was detected by ELESA,and synovium examined pathologically. Results Compared with the model group,rHDL74 and rHDLwt dramatically inhibited swelling of the rat ankles(F=9.61-45.84,q=2.13-16.35,P0.05),lowered the levels of serum IL-1β(F=43.67,q=2.33-16.85,P0.05),and depressed inflammatory cell infiltration induced by urate crystals. Conclusion rHDL74 and rHDLwt show a remarkable effectiveness in improving symptoms of acute gouty arthritis induced by sodium urate crystals in rats
